A student was asked to identify an unknown hydrate by following the procedure described in this module. After heating and cooling, a 2.752-g sample of this unknown weighed 1.941 g. Students were given a list of possible compounds from which to identify their unknowns: LiNO3 . 3 H20, Ca(NO3)2 . 4 H2O, and Sr(NO3)2 . 4 H2O.
a) Calculate percent water in the students unknown.b) Could the unknown possibly have been Sr(NO3)2 . 4 H2O? Briefly explain.c) What is the probable identity of the students unknown?d) Based on the students results and your answer to (c), what is the most probable source of error in the experiment?A student was asked to identify an unknow hydrate by following the procedure described in this module.
